Invisalign vs. Traditional Braces: Which Is Right for You?

Deciding between Invisalign and traditional braces depends primarily on your case complexity, lifestyle, and aesthetic preferences. Invisalign uses removable clear aligners that are virtually invisible, making them ideal for adults and teens with mild-to-moderate alignment needs. Traditional braces are permanently bonded to the teeth and utilize brackets and wires, making them the superior choice for complex orthodontic issues and severe bite corrections.

Side-by-Side Comparison: Invisalign vs. Traditional Braces

Feature Invisalign Traditional Braces
Visibility Nearly invisible, clear plastic trays Highly visible, metal brackets and wires
Removability Yes (remove to eat, brush, and floss) No (permanently fixed during treatment)
Average Cost Comparable investment; varies by case Comparable investment; varies by case
Treatment Time 12 - 18 months on average 18 - 24 months on average
Maintenance Clean aligners daily; normal brushing/flossing Special threaders, brush around brackets
Dietary Restrictions None (remove trays before eating) Avoid sticky, hard, or chewy foods

Invisalign: The Modern Clear Solution

Invisalign relies on a series of custom-milled, medical-grade polyurethane trays that exert gentle, localized pressure on your teeth, shifting them into place over time. Every two weeks, you swap your current tray set for the next one in the sequence.

Because they are clear and removable, they appeal greatly to professionals and socially active teenagers. They demand high discipline, however, as aligners must be worn 22 hours a day. Learn more about the aligner process in our Invisalign treatment overview.

Traditional Braces: The Reliable Powerhouse

Metal braces are the time-tested anchor of orthodontics. Stainless steel brackets are glued to the teeth and linked by archwires, which are tightened regularly by your dentist to guide teeth into alignment.

For patients with severe rotated teeth, complex bite issues (like severe overbites or underbites), or jaw discrepancies, traditional braces remain the most precise and powerful tool available. Frequently Asked Questions

Which is faster: Invisalign or traditional braces?

For mild-to-moderate alignment issues, Invisalign is often faster, taking between 12 and 18 months on average. However, traditional braces are generally faster and more efficient for severe structural corrections and complex bite alignments.

Is Invisalign more comfortable than traditional braces?

Yes, Invisalign is widely considered more comfortable because it uses smooth, custom-molded medical-grade plastic aligners that do not cause metal cuts or irritation. Traditional braces feature metal brackets and wires that can initially poke the cheeks and lips.

What is the difference in maintenance between Invisalign and braces?

Invisalign aligners are removable, allowing you to brush and floss normally and eat any food without restrictions. Metal braces are fixed, requiring specialized floss threaders, careful brushing, and the avoidance of hard, sticky, or chewy foods.
